I can't comment on the speed, but the RectsHit command might be what you're looking for:
RectsHit (X1,Y1,Width1,Height1,X2,Y2,Width2,Height2)
Returns true if they overlap.
I love that, in the manual, they actually say "Care should be taken with the pronunciation of this command."